基于云计算的变电站设备智能化运维平台设计与实现

提出了一种基于云计算的变电站设备智能化运维平台.该平台利用边缘计算在变电站本地部署智能节点,实现数据的采集与分析;同时,利用联邦学习实现多个变电站智能运维模型的协同训练与知识融合,在保护数据隐私的前提下提升模型性能.该平台还通过充分利用云计算在边缘和模型训练2个层面的技术优势,实现了变电站设备状态监测、故障诊断以及健康评估等全流程运维功能.实验表明,该平台有效提升了变电站运行监测能力和故障处理效率.
Design and Implementation of an Intelligent Operation and Maintenance Platform for Substation Equipment Based on Cloud Computing
A cloud computing based intelligent operation and maintenance platform for substation equipment has been proposed.The platform uses edge computing to deploy intelligent nodes in the local substation to achieve data collection and analysis.At the same time,utilizing federated learning to achieve collaborative training and knowledge fusion of intelligent operation and maintenance models for multiple substations can improve model performance while protecting data privacy.The platform also fully utilizes the technological advantages of cloud computing at the edge and model training levels to achieve full process operation and maintenance functions such as substation equipment status monitoring,fault diagnosis,and health assessment.The experiment shows that the platform effectively improves the monitoring capability and fault handling efficiency of substations.
